Meta’s Voicebox 2.0 Shakes Up Multilingual AI Audio: First Impressions & Benchmark Results

MENLO PARK, CA, June 2026 — Meta has officially launched Voicebox 2.0, its next-generation multilingual AI audio model, setting a new benchmark for quality and versatility in speech synthesis. The release promises to redefine standards for real-time, cross-lingual audio generation, capturing the attention of developers, enterprises, and AI researchers worldwide.

Why does this matter? With global communication and content creation increasingly reliant on AI, Meta’s leap forward in natural, expressive, and multi-language voice generation could disrupt everything from accessibility tools to entertainment production and virtual assistants.

Key Features and Benchmark Insights

  • Multilingual Mastery: Voicebox 2.0 supports over 50 languages and dialects, with seamless code-switching in real time.
  • Expressive Synthesis: The model generates human-like emotions, intonations, and conversational nuances with unprecedented accuracy.
  • Speed and Efficiency: Benchmarks reveal Voicebox 2.0 can generate natural-sounding speech at 2.5x the speed of its predecessor, with a 35% reduction in computational overhead.
  • Robustness: Early testing shows a 45% decrease in mispronunciations and accent artifacts compared to leading alternatives.
  • Zero-Shot and Style Transfer: Users can clone voices and transfer speaking styles across languages with just a few seconds of audio input.

According to Meta, these improvements stem from a combination of larger, more diverse training datasets, optimized transformer architectures, and a proprietary data augmentation pipeline.

“Voicebox 2.0 is a milestone for accessible, expressive AI audio. We’re seeing near-human performance, even in low-resource languages,” said Dr. Priya Raman, Meta’s AI Audio Lead.

Technical Implications and Industry Impact

The technical leap embodied by Voicebox 2.0 could reshape the audio AI landscape in several ways:

  • Globalization of Content: Content creators can now instantly localize podcasts, audiobooks, and videos in dozens of languages, with voices that sound native and emotionally authentic.
  • Accessibility: Enhanced voice synthesis will boost tools for the visually impaired and support real-time translation in education and public services.
  • Enterprise Applications: Customer support bots, voice-driven agents, and virtual assistants stand to gain more natural, trustworthy voices—potentially raising the bar set by current offerings, as explored in recent AI customer support deployments.
  • Creative Industries: Voicebox 2.0’s style transfer and cloning features open new frontiers for music, film dubbing, and interactive entertainment. This echoes a broader trend in generative AI’s influence on creative workflows, as discussed in the evolution of AI music production.

Meta’s move also intensifies competition in the generative AI space, where audio capabilities are rapidly becoming a key differentiator. For a full landscape view, see The State of Generative AI 2026.

What It Means for Developers and Users

The Voicebox 2.0 SDK and API, available today in limited beta, bring several practical enhancements:

  • Plug-and-Play Integration: Developers can embed multilingual, expressive speech into apps with minimal setup—no deep AI expertise required.
  • Customization: Fine-tune voices for brand or character consistency across languages, with granular control over emotion and pacing.
  • Compliance and Privacy: Meta claims improved safeguards for voice cloning, including watermarking and opt-out mechanisms, addressing some regulatory concerns highlighted in the latest AI regulation analysis.
  • Lower Barrier to Entry: The efficiency gains mean that even startups and smaller teams can deploy advanced voice features without prohibitive cloud costs.

Initial feedback from beta testers is positive. “The ability to switch between Mandarin, Spanish, and English mid-sentence—without losing tone or flow—is game-changing for our global user base,” said Anya Lopez, CTO at a leading language learning app.
